Isaac Van Zandt and Frances Van Zandt Monument (Canton, Texas) Historic Isaac Van Zandt and Frances Van Zandt Monument on the grounds of the Van Zandt County courthouse in Canton, Texas.  The monument contains a bas-relief sculpture of the County’s namesake and his wife.   It was erected in 1938 as part of the 1936 Texas Centennial celebration.

The monument was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 2017 as a contributing object to the Van Zandt County Courthouse listing (NRHP No. 100000698).

The Edgewood Historical Society is a non-profit organization dedicated to preserving the history of Edgewood, Texas. Located in the heart of Edgewood, the society is housed in a historic building that was once the town's first bank. The society was founded in 1998 by a group of local residents who had a passion for the town's history and wanted to ensure that it was preserved for future generations.

The society's mission is to collect, preserve, and share the history of Edgewood through education, research, and community outreach. The society has a vast collection of artifacts, photographs, and documents that tell the story of Edgewood's past. The society also maintains a library of books and resources that are available to the public for research purposes.

The society hosts regular events and programs that are open to the public, including historical tours, lectures, and exhibits. The society also publishes a quarterly newsletter that features articles on local history and updates on society events and activities.

Membership in the Edgewood Historical Society is open to anyone who is interested in the town's history. Members receive access to the society's resources and are invited to participate in society events and programs. The society is an important part of the Edgewood community and plays a vital role in preserving the town's rich history.
